Repairs: Subsequent repairs should only be done by qualified personnel with the necessary know-how and
experience.
When carrying out repairs, the chain as a whole must be repaired; individual pieces that are broken, obviously
deformed or stretched, heavily corroded, coated with non-removable debris (e.g. weld splatter), have deep cuts,
notches, grooves, cracks should be replaced immediately. Missing safety device such as safety latches, triggers,
pins as well as damaged, broken or missing springs should be replaced. Only use original pewag replacement parts
and accessories of the correct quality grade and nominal size. winner accessories can be used to repair Nicroman
lifting chains – new bolts, adapter sleeves and other safety elements are advisable.
Missing identification tags can be replaced with a new tag, but only after all the necessary tests have been
conducted and the load capacity is ascertainable using the markings on the individual parts and type.
Small cuts, notches and grooves can be eliminated (e.g. on large hooks or lifting chains) by carefully grinding or
filing. The newly repaired part should blend seamlessly into the adjoining material without there being a marked
difference in the cross-section. Through eliminating the damage, the material thickness must not have decreased by
more than 10 % – after the repairs, the chain should not fit into any of the "discard" categories.
Repairs that involve welding should only be carried out by pewag.
Documentation: The tests conducted by trained personnel, the outcomes as well as the maintenance logs should
be documented in a chain card index which should be kept for the whole of the product's working life.
These recordings and/or the manufacturer's declaration of compliance and conformity need to be shown to the
national trade control on demand.
Storing, Transportation
Lifting chains that are not being used should be stored on designated frames and not in a heap on the floor as that
would be the fastest way to damage them.
If unloaded lifting chains remain on the crane hook, then the end hook must be attached into the master link or,
if this is the case, the end links into the crane hook in order to reduce the risk chains sling legs swinging freely or
accidentally unhooking.
